Dreaming About Taking an Important Test: What It Means

Have you just woken up from a vivid dream about taking an important test? You're not alone—this scenario frequently signals feelings of anxiety or self-evaluation in your waking life.

Many find that dreaming of tests is tied to moments of stress or significant life changes, and can often reflect how prepared you feel for challenges ahead.

What This Dream Typically Means

Dreaming about taking an important test commonly indicates feelings of self-doubt, anxiety, or pressure to perform. It often reflects situations where you feel your abilities are being evaluated, whether by others or yourself.

This type of dream might surface when you're facing a critical decision or transition, suggesting that you’re subconsciously assessing your readiness to meet new demands.

The Psychology Behind Test Dreams

From a psychological perspective, dreams about tests are linked to the continuity hypothesis, which suggests that our dreams mirror our waking life concerns. This means that if you're anxious about an event or responsibility, it may manifest as testing in your dream.

Moreover, these dreams often serve as a way for your mind to process emotions associated with fear of failure or the desire to achieve certain goals, helping you to mentally rehearse and prepare.

Common Variations of the Dream and Their Meanings

One common variation involves feeling unprepared or forgetting something important during the test. This typically signifies anxiety about not meeting expectations in real life or worries about past mistakes resurfacing.

Another variant is finding yourself taking a test you believe you have already passed. This often reflects themes of repetitive life challenges or the feeling that you’re stuck in a cycle of evaluation. You may need to reflect on your current goals and progress.

When These Dreams Tend to Recur

Test-related dreams frequently recur during periods of heightened stress, such as when studying for exams, starting a new job, or entering a major life phase. Their recurrence indicates that your subconscious is actively processing these pressures.

These dreams can also appear during times of life transition, such as graduation or career changes, highlighting your individual concerns about adequacy and success.

What to Pay Attention to in Waking Life

If you find yourself dreaming about taking an important test, it may be a prompt to evaluate how you're managing stress and expectations in your life. Pay attention to areas where you feel underprepared or overwhelmed, as these may need addressing.

Reflect on your goals and confidence levels; consider setting smaller, achievable objectives to build up your self-esteem. Engaging in self-care practices can also help mitigate the anxiety reflected in these dreams.

Frequently asked

Is a dream about taking a test a bad omen?

Not necessarily. While it can signal anxiety, it often points to areas where you may need to focus on self-improvement or manage stress.

Why do I keep dreaming about taking tests?

Recurring dreams about tests can indicate ongoing pressures or self-evaluations in your waking life and may be linked to specific stressors you're facing.

What does it mean if I fail a test in my dream?

Failing a test in your dream typically reflects feelings of inadequacy or the fear of not measuring up to expectations, whether they're self-imposed or from external sources.

Can dreaming about tests help me in real life?

Yes, these dreams can provide insight into your stress levels and prepare you to confront challenges, helping you develop strategies to tackle real-life situations.

How can I stop having anxiety dreams about tests?

Managing stress through relaxation techniques, regular exercise, and addressing any root causes of anxiety can help reduce the frequency of these dreams.
